    HIGH-PERFORMANCE TANGENTIAL FLOW OR CROSSFLOW FILTRATION

    -- Using thin (~50 μm) micro-porous metal and ceramic membranes

        1. Application

                Removal of large volume fraction of clarified solution from a solid-containing solution

        2. Performance Attributes

               a) Highly permeable to various fluids from water, solvents, ionic liquids, to oil

               b) Bio and chemical-fouling resistance

               c) Effective over a broad range of temperature and pressures

               d) Low cross-flow velocity for minimization of particle breakage and power consumption

               e) Cleanable by forward flushing, backflushing, and chemical cleaning

        3. Example . Concentration of microalgae culture on the lab cell loaded with zirconia- coated nickel sheet membrane
            Filtration conditions: 0.55 bar feed pressure, 2.6 cm/s crossflow velocity, permeate side at atmospheric pressure

           Results: 11-fold concentration, permeate turbidity = 0.00, no algal adhesion on the membrane

    Molecule Works Inc. (MWI) is a US-based technology company, registered in the State of Washington, and established in 2015 to pursue commercialization of three fundamental inventions licensed from Pacific Northwest National Laboratory (PNNL): thin porous metal sheet, thin-sheet zeolite membrane, and cassette-type membrane module. Since then, MWI has successfully demonstrated scale-up of all the critical membrane preparation steps and established its proprietary pilot manufacturing capabilities for production of thin porous metal and zeolite membrane sheets. The pilot-scale manufacturing capabilities enable production of a large number of 20cm x 20cm membrane sheets for application prototype development and customer sampling.

    MWI has developed several innovative manufacturing methods and processes for production of the porous metal sheet-based membrane products at low cost. MWI has also made a series of new inventions for applications of its membrane products.
